The song that embraced the world

An atmospheric classical Christmas concert in which soprano Marit Kristine Risnes, cellist Olav Stener Olsen and Goedele Taveirne at the grand piano present traditional and well-known Christmas songs in an acoustic format. ‘Stille Nacht, Heilige Nacht’ by Franz Gruber, the song that has embraced generations and continues to touch hearts around the world, originated on Christmas Eve in a village in Austria on Christmas Eve 1818, over 200 years ago. The organ in St. Nicolaus was out of order, and to create atmosphere during evening mass, organist Gruber composed a song that could be sung to a simple lute accompaniment. Thus, the world premiere of the world's most famous Christmas carol, Silent Night, took place on Christmas Eve in Oberndorf.
